XAMPP suffers from multiple XSS issues in several scripts that use the 'PHP_SELF' variable. The vulnerabilities can be triggered in the 'xamppsecurity.php', 'cds.php' and 'perlinfo.pl' because there isn't any filtering to the mentioned variable in the affected scripts. Attackers can exploit these weaknesses to execute arbitrary HTML and script code in a user's browser session.
The session list screen (provided by sessionList.jsp) in affected versions uses the orderBy and sort request parameters without applying filtering and therefore is vulnerable to a cross-site scripting attack. Users should be aware that Tomcat 6 does not use httpOnly for session cookies by default so this vulnerability could expose session cookies from the manager application to an attacker.

Windows Meeting Space is prone to a vulnerability that may allow the execution of any library file named wab32res.dll, if this dll is located in the same folder as a .WCINV file.
The Rhino Script Engine of Oracle Java fails to properly check for permissions on JavaScript error objects. This flaw allows an unprivileged applet to escape the sandbox and execute arbitrary code on the target machine with the privileges of the current user.
The vulnerability is caused due to an error when processing certain packets and can be exploited to cause a crash via a specially crafted packet sent to TCP port 2194.
The Ancillary Function Driver (AFD.sys) present in Microsoft Windows is vulnerable to an arbitrary pointer overwrite. This module allows a local unprivileged user to execute arbitrary code with SYSTEM privileges by sending a specially crafted IOCTL to the vulnerable driver.
